Field data
  • Janka hardness 880 lbfred oak ≈ 1,290 lbf
  • Density ≈ 35 lb/ft³specific gravity 0.5 at 12% MC
  • Shrinkage — tangential 7.6%flatsawn width, green → ovendry
  • Shrinkage — radial 4.2%quartersawn width
  • T/R ratio 1.8 : 1higher = more cupping in flatsawn stock

Shop notes The swamp-grown tupelo whose light root wood is prized by decoy carvers; the upper log works like blackgum.

Seasonal movement at a glance

Width change for water tupelo across a typical indoor year — 6% moisture content in the heated winter to 12% in a humid summer:

Board widthFlatsawnQuartersawn
6″ 3/32″ (0.098″) 1/16″ (0.054″)
12″ 3/16″ (0.195″) 3/32″ (0.108″)
24″ 13/32″ (0.391″) 7/32″ (0.216″)
36″ 19/32″ (0.586″) 5/16″ (0.324″)

Water Tupelo questions

How much does water tupelo move with the seasons?

A 12″-wide flatsawn water tupelo board moves about 3/16″ across a typical indoor swing from 6% to 12% moisture content; quartersawn, about 3/32″. Its tangential shrinkage is 7.6% and radial 4.2% (green to ovendry) — a moderate-movement wood.

How hard is water tupelo?

Water Tupelo rates about 880 lbf on the Janka scale — softer than red oak but sturdy (red oak is roughly 1,290 lbf). Density runs about 35 lb/ft³ at indoor moisture levels.

Is water tupelo good for wide panels and tabletops?

Yes, with normal precautions: its 1.8:1 tangential-to-radial ratio is moderate. Still fasten solid tops so they can move across their width.

Shrinkage, specific gravity, and hardness from the Wood Handbook, FPL-GTR-282 (2021 edition), USDA Forest Products Laboratory (public domain). Values are species averages — individual boards vary with growth conditions and how they were dried.
